> I think it's a good idea actually, though it would be nice if the
> mailing list sign-up site mentioned the FAQ/Wiki as a place to look
> before posting.
>
> Paul.
How about a first-post response? I have seen this work well with other
lists. The first time a new user posts, they get automailed mailed a
brief netiquette flyer and a FAQ list. Their post still goes to the
list, but, by and large, they will read the FAQ and explore the links
while waiting for an answer. One could even get real fancy and do a
search against the archives/FAQ for topics related to their post, but
that may be overboard.
